The InviziQ™ Pressure Sewer System is a smarter alternative to conventional gravity sewage options. Rather than relying on gravity and a network of costly lift stations to transfer sewage, PSS utilizes reliable grinding and pumping technology to efficiently and responsibly move sewage to treatment facilities – no matter the terrain, slope, environmental sensitivity of the area or complex topography of the region.

Features

  • Unique, clean dry well is sealed and tested to eliminate water or sewage intrusion
  • Tank and piping are sealed and tested to reduce I&I to zero to not allow inflow or infiltration
  • Standard TEFC pump motor located in dry well is out of sewage, unlike other vendors who offer expensive submersible motors
  • Cleanout/observation port is large enough to accommodate cleanout hose, so there is no need to remove dry well cover
  • Robust grinder pump offers zero planned maintenance. The all stainless steel pump cartridge provides reliable performance.
  • Leading edge, solid-state level sensor provides more reliability than traditional, mechanical float alternatives. Also resistant to corrosion and grease-build up. Transducer allows adjustment of ON/OFF/ALARM set points to maximize capacity.
